Responsible Gambling Tools

Licensed operators offer various tools to help you stay in control of your gambling. These tools are designed to prevent problem gambling and promote a healthy relationship with casino games. Some of the most common tools include:

  • Deposit Limits: Set a maximum amount you can deposit within a specific timeframe (daily, weekly, or monthly). This helps you manage your spending.
  • Loss Limits: Set a maximum amount you are willing to lose within a specific timeframe. This helps prevent chasing losses.
  • Time Limits: Set limits on how long you can play in a session. This helps you avoid spending too much time gambling.
  • Self-Exclusion: Take a break from gambling by temporarily or permanently excluding yourself from the site. This is a powerful tool if you feel you need a longer break.
  • Reality Checks: Receive regular reminders of how long you’ve been playing and how much you’ve spent.

Verification and Security Measures

Licensed casinos take security seriously. They use various measures to protect your information and prevent fraud. These include:

  • Know Your Customer (KYC) Procedures: Operators verify your identity to prevent underage gambling and money laundering. This usually involves providing identification documents.
  • Secure Payment Methods: Licensed casinos use secure payment gateways to protect your financial transactions.
  • Data Encryption: Your personal and financial information is encrypted to prevent unauthorized access.

How to Spot a Safe and Licensed Online Casino

Knowing how to identify a safe and licensed online casino is crucial. Here are some things to look for:

  • Licensing Information: The casino should clearly display its license information, including the issuing authority (e.g., Northern Territory Racing Commission, ACMA). This information is usually found at the bottom of the website.
  • Security Certificates: Look for security certificates, such as SSL encryption, which indicate that the website is secure.
  • Responsible Gambling Tools: The casino should offer a range of responsible gambling tools, such as deposit limits, loss limits, and self-exclusion options.
  • Fair Play Audits: The casino should be audited by independent testing agencies, such as eCOGRA or iTech Labs. Look for their logos on the website.
  • Positive Reviews: Read reviews from other players to get an idea of the casino’s reputation.
